WIRELESS MODULE TROUBLESHOOTING AND OPERATION
BRIDGE MODULE:
The Red STATUS LED located near the center of the board
blinks when a message is received from the LC3000 Reader.
Communication is over RS-485. When the bridge is attached
to the LC3000 Reader, the red status LED should blink once
per second. If the LED is not blinking, the bridge has not
been configured in the reader (see: the
Wireless Bridge
LE3/BRIDGE Installation (page 23)).
The Green TRANSMIT LED located near the edge of the
board is turned on whenever a radio packet is being
transmitted by the Bridge.
The Red ERROR LED located near the edge of the board is turned on when a radio packet was not
received from a polled LWI module or if an error was detected in the received packet.
When LWI Modules are configured in the LC3000 Reader, the green TRANSMIT LED on the Bridge will
start blinking. This indicates the Bridge is transmitting packets to the module. If the module is not
responding, the Red Error LED will blink as well.
The red ERROR LED starts blinking immediately as each LWI module is configured. This
continues until the module has been installed in the Laundry machine and it has locked to the
Bridge.
